Output 1688c33569a5a963c53a768f0785b18e4eb4fa5f2c1136f745322df0efcfa5ed:0

value
452525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c693e3f2373042499ccd453b4627286248cb047 OP_EQUAL
address
3EVSbpeapEp63fpDg4b6QtvV5znx96V3xv
transaction
1688c33569a5a963c53a768f0785b18e4eb4fa5f2c1136f745322df0efcfa5ed
confirmations
326968
spent
true